  • Abstract
    A circuit has been developed which allows excitation of charge sensitive amplifiers at high pulse repetition rates. The amplifier output waveform fidelity is nearly as good as that associated with low repetition rate mercury relay pulsers. The circuit may be self-contained or operated under external control by supplying a reference voltage and clock signals to initiate pulses. The elements of the pulser are discussed in detail, and some applications are suggested. The circuit has been tested for amplitude stability as a function of temperature and pulse repetition rate.
